I went to Duke for my six month ultrasound and bloodwork. It appears all is stable with my cirrhosis. Still well compensated and no signs of portal hypertension, ascities, etc. Liver blood numbers are good. Kidney function tests were way off, but with high diuretic doses and heart problems, that’s become the new focus. We’re hoping I was just very dehydrated. But, it appears my new Tricuspid heart valve that replaced my old one that caused the cirrhosis is working like it should and my liver is behaving. Prayers appreciated for my kidneys now.
